What are Tools Sales Associates?

Tools Sales Associates are retail professionals who assist customers in selecting, purchasing, and understanding various tools and hardware products. They provide product knowledge, make recommendations based on customer needs, and help ensure a positive shopping experience. Tools Sales Associates are often responsible for stocking shelves, maintaining displays, and staying informed about the latest tools and equipment. They may also handle transactions and answer questions about warranties, use, and safety. This role requires good communication skills and a basic understanding of different types of tools.

What are some common challenges Tools Sales Associates face when helping customers select the right tools?

Tools Sales Associates often encounter customers who are unsure about which tool best fits their needs, especially with the wide variety of options available. A key challenge is effectively communicating the differences between similar products and guiding customers toward the most suitable choice for their project or skill level. Associates must stay updated on new tool technologies and product lines, as well as maintain strong product knowledge to build trust and provide accurate recommendations. Building rapport and managing multiple customer requests during busy periods can also require strong multitasking and interpersonal skills.

Tools Sales Associates and Hardware Sales Associates often share similar roles in retail environments, focusing on customer service and product knowledge. The main difference lies in the product specialization: Tools Sales Associates primarily handle power tools and hand tools, while Hardware Sales Associates deal with a broader range of hardware supplies. Both roles require similar skills and are found in comparable retail settings.
